Spinning off from the incredibly popular 1960s sitcom and its BAFTA-winning 1970s sequel, James Bolam and Rodney Bewes star as Terry Collier and Bob Ferris, two life-long friends with vastly different outlooks on life. Written by comedy legends Dick Clement and Ian La Frenais – who would go on to further success with series like Porridge and Auf Wiedersehen, Pet – The Likely Lads is presented here as a brand-new High Definition remaster from the original film elements in its original theatrical aspect ratio.
Thelma's continued annoyance at her husband Bob's disruptive friend Terry shows no sign of abating. But when Terry lands himself a new girlfriend, Thelma sees her chance to finally get him married off and out of her's and Bob's lives forever! Her solution of touring the north of England in a caravan, however, leaves a lot to be desired...
SPECIAL FEATURE: TWO NEWLY-RECOVERED EPISODES FROM THE ORIGINAL BBCTV SERIES! Also featured in this release are two episodes from the original series believed lost for over fifty years: A Star is Born and Far Away Places. Unseen since the 1960s they are both presented here as new High Definition remasters.

Shot on 35mm by seasoned film directors, the ITC action adventure series' high production values allowed key episodes to be easily presented as full-length movies for European cinema exhibition. Mid '60s favourite The Baron yielded two films assembled from two-part stories: The Man in a Looking Glass and Mystery Island.
Restored from brand-new High Definition masters created by Network's award-winning inhouse Restoration Team, both movies are presented here in widescreen format alongside the fullscreen versions of the four episodes from which they are comprised.

Alfred Burke stars as down-at-heel inquiry agent Frank Marker in this critically acclaimed, long-running drama series. Always working the lower end of the spectrum – divorces, missing persons, bankruptcies – Marker's highly sympathetic character found great favour with viewers and Public Eye's enormous popularity endured throughout its ten-year lifespan and beyond. In common with many series made in the 1960s and '70s, a large number of episodes were junked; this set contains every surviving episode, together with the following special features:

Tim Curry gives a memorable performance in this classic six-part prestige drama from award-winning writer John Mortimer. Based around the sixteen years that William Shakespeare is known to have spent in London, each episode is built around the creation of a single play as Mortimer's skilful interweaving of known events and contemporary interpretation shows how key experiences may have inspired some of Shakespeare's greatest works.
Co-starring Ian McShane (as Marlowe), Paul Freeman, Meg Wynn Owen and Nicholas Clay, Will Shakespeare lavishly recreates the bustling taverns and theatres of Elizabethan London in which the frailties and strengths of one of the world's greatest dramatists are brought vividly to life.

Frank Ross did the crime and then did the time – but now he's out! A consummate professional, he'd never have been caught were he not grassed up – and now he'll stop at nothing to uncover the snitch and unearth the secret, a secret certain people in the criminal underworld will do anything to protect.
Tom Bell gives a career-best, BAFTA-nominated performance in this '70s gangster noir from Trevor Preston, a key writer on The Sweeney and creator of cult favourite Ace of Wands. Co-starring Brian Croucher, Lynn Farleigh, Brian Cox, Derrick O'Connor and Bryan Marshall, and directed by BAFTA award-winner Jim Goddard, Out is presented here as a brand-new High Definition restoration from original film elements in its original fullscreen aspect ratio.

Further Out of Town: Volume Two offers more memorable snapshots of the British countryside from a bygone age. This brand-new series showcases digitally restored film sequences from Jack Hargeaves' hugely popular television series, introduced by his stepson, Simon Baddeley.
Running for over twenty years, the original Out of Town programme saw Jack Hargreaves exploring country life in Britain; his easygoing presentation style and extensive knowledge and love of the countryside enthralling viewers of all generations.
When the series ended, Jack saved from destruction many hours' worth of Out of Town film footage. It is this material - much of it unseen for decades - that has been painstakingly restored and revisited to produce six more new episodes of Further Out of Town, featured here.

EastEnders legend Leslie Grantham stars as maverick cop Mick Raynor in this hard-hitting crime thriller set in the no-man's land where the underworld meets the establishment. Created by multi-award-winning writer Terry Johnson and co-starring Robert Stephens and Frances Tomelty, this release contains all fourteen episodes of the uncompromising drama series.
Going undercover as a bent ex-copper, Mick Raynor walks a razor's edge as he infiltrates the complex web of organised crime and high-level corruption that lurks beneath the surface of British public life. Intent on landing the big fish – the gangsters with knighthoods, the politicians laundering money – he faces dangerous assignments that stretch his nerves to the very limit.
A landmark comedy production for 1970s British television, The Fosters was the first sitcom written for and starring black actors. This hit comedy showcases the early work of Lenny Henry as the budding artist son of an easygoing family man and his feisty wife (played by Norman Beaton and Isabelle Lucas), immigrants now living on a south London housing estate.
Produced by Stuart Allen – who by this point had made On the Buses, Love Thy Neighbour, Billy Liar and Romany Jones – and adapted from scripts written for the long-running US comedy series Good Times, this release contains both series and the 1977 New Year special.
BAFTA-nominated actor Maureen Lipman stars as an agony aunt with problems of her own in this daringly risque 1970s sitcom. Co-starring Simon Williams, Bill Nighy, Please Sir's Peter Denyer and Dear John's Peter Blake, Agony was based on the experiences of real-life "Agony Aunt" Anna Raeburn and deftly trod a sharp line of black humour throughout its three series.
Agony aunt Jane Lucas runs the problem page for Person magazine alongside her own radio phone-in programme. But while Jane's life is devoted to solving other people's problems, she often finds it far too difficult to solve her own!
Timeslip star Spencer Banks heads the cast of this tense espionage series created and written by Victor Pemberton, whose previous credits include key stories for Doctor Who and Ace of Wands. Though originally made in colour only black and white telerecordings now exist and they were transferred for this release.
Martin Clifford lives in a quiet English village and is busy studying for his exams when he suddenly finds himself at the centre of a dangerous espionage plot! The nearby USAF base has been selected to become the communications centre for top-secret NATO exercises and Martin is tasked with assisting British Intelligence to uncover enemy agents at large in the village.

A television legend, Crossroads was one of ITV's most popular shows. Starring the immortal Noele Gordon as Meg Richardson, the trials and tribulations of the Midlands' premier motel, its staff and patrons enthralled, amused and sometimes horrified millions of viewers for the best part of three decades! A huge presence on ITV from the 1950s onwards, Gordon consistently won viewer awards through the '60s and '70s for both her own performance and for the series with which she is forever linked.
Nearly two decades in the making, Crossroads: The Noele Gordon Collection is an exclusive box set of 90+ discs (over 700 shows) containing every known existing episode from the earliest surviving show through to Gordon's final performance in November 1981 (wrapping the set up with the last show transmitted by ATV on New Year's Eve 1981). Over a sixty year career Gerry Anderson created some of the world's most beloved children's television series - including Thunderbirds, Stingray, Captain Scarlet, Space:1999, Terrahawks and Space Precinct. In a fitting tribute to this television and film pioneer Gerry Anderson: A Life Uncharted uses a wealth of intimate audio archive combined with cutting-edge AI deepfake technology to allow Gerry to tell his own story on screen for the first time.
With exclusive access to previously unpublished interviews alongside new contributions from friends, family and colleagues, this emotionally charged and deeply personal documentary shares the untold stories that defined his life and body of work. From a poverty-stricken childhood raised by a Jewish father and an antisemitic mother, through a lifetime of personal struggles, this documentary maps Gerry's previously uncharted journey to puppetry pioneer, science fiction master and legendary creator.

The highly popular semi-sequel to ABC's smash-hit Pathfinders trilogy, the two Beneath the Sea series star Gerald Flood as an intrepid reporter once again caught up in situations beyond his control. Created by cult favourite writer John Lucarotti (known for his memorable work on Doctor Who, The Avengers, Into the Labyrinth and Star Maidens) both series see scientific journalist Mark Bannerman and his assistant Peter Blake get into (and out of!) all manner of aquatic scrapes.
When Bannerman and Blake are invited aboard an atomic submarine to observe the trials of a new underwater transmitter, they embark on an adventure which leads them into the depths of inner space.

Legendary producer Sydney Newman's Pathfinders trilogy was one of ITV's earliest dramas written specifically for children and a precursor to the development of Doctor Who. Over three series the Pathfinders journeyed to the Moon and other worlds, proving successful with the viewing public and even getting into the regional top ten on occasion – unheard of for a children's programme.
With intelligent and engaging scripts by Malcolm Hulke and Eric Paice, the Pathfinders faced drama and excitement at every turn – from space hazards to Venusian dinosaurs! This set contains all three series: Pathfinders in Space, Pathfinders to Mars and Pathfinders to Venus.

Gerry Anderson created some of the world's most explosively colourful action series of the 1960s and '70s: Thunderbirds, Stingray, Captain Scarlet and Space:1999's vivid visuals stick in the mind long after viewing, their rich, multi-coloured imagery as memorable as their stories, performances and special effects.
But prior to Stingray Gerry produced three series in black and white - their only colour representation being a small number of on-set stills taken during production. Using these as a basis, key episodes of Four Feather Falls, Supercar and Fireball XL5 have been colourised from High Definition remasters using state-of-the-art software, enabling fans to see their favourite shows in a whole new way!

One of the most successful television series ever made, The Adventures of Black Beauty's winning mix of charm, period detail and mild peril thrilled viewers the world over – and five decades later it still remains a benchmark production in children's television. Newly-scanned and remastered from existing film elements, the complete series is presented here in High Definition for the first time. Featuring scripts by Ted Willis, Richard Carpenter, Victor Pemberton and David Butler, among others, this series guest-starred John Thaw, Geoffrey Bayldon, Peter Bowles, Mike Pratt, Jack Shepherd, Stuart Damon, Lesley Dunlop and Gerald Flood.
Dr James Gordon has moved from London to the country. His two children explore Five Oaks and find an exhausted, wounded horse. They become very attached to the animal as they bring him back to health – so it comes as a shock when his owner tries to reclaim him.

"Welcome to Fortean TV, a celebration of the miraculous, the mysterious and the downright weird!"
One of television's most popular paranormal series – and an influence on many shows that followed – Fortean TV's vast collection of esoteric stories form the basis of one of the world's most valuable libraries of the bizarre, the occult and all points inbetween!
Hosted by the intrepid Reverend Lionel Fanthorpe, this cult series examines the strangest supernatural phenomena from around the world. Hauntings, Yeti, aliens, a pork scratching that resembles the Virgin Mary: Fortean TV leaves no stone unturned in its quest to unearth the inexplicable, the eccentric and the just plain bizarre!
This complete series release features all 18 episodes, the harder-edged Uncut spin-off and the highly memorable Christmas special!
Una Stubbs and Lionel Blair captain two teams of celebrities in this light-hearted battle of the sexes! Hosted by Michael Aspel, each contestant has two minutes to get their teammates to guess their mime – otherwise it's thrown open to the other team for a bonus point!
The shows on this set feature a galaxy of celebrities, comedians and actors, including: Kenneth Williams, Diana Dors, Richard O'Sullivan, Barbara Windsor, Robin Askwith, David Jason, Yootha Joyce, Mollie Sugden, Paula Wilcox, Spike Milligan, Russ Abbot, Warren Mitchell, Kenny Everett, June Whitfield, Terry Scott, Dick Emery, Maureen Lipman, Beryl Reid, Rodney Bewes, Faith Brown, Paul Eddington, John Inman, Dudley Moore, Victoria Wood, all three Goodies and two Doctors Who!
World premiered on 16th April 2022 at Symphony Hall, Birmingham, Stand by for Action! Gerry Anderson in Concert is a unique celebration of the life and work of pioneering producer Gerry Anderson. Hosted by Jon Culshaw, this was the first time a career-spanning collection of music from Gerry's shows had ever been performed live in concert, brought to life by a full orchestra with a special appearance from BAFTA-winning composer, Anderson alumnus and conductor Richard Harvey.
Through this FAB show you will be transported through Gerry's back catalogue as it pays homage to his remarkable partnership with composers including Barry Gray, Richard Harvey and Crispin Merrell. The iconic theme tunes and incidental music from classic Anderson shows – including Thunderbirds, Space: 1999, Captain Scarlet and UFO – are performed alongside that of his earliest work like The Adventures of Twizzle, Torchy the Battery Boy and Four Feather Falls, right through to Terrahawks, Space Precinct and his final production: New Captain Scarlet.
